Lyndall Lou Ritchie

Lindy Ritchie, 82, of Nocona, passed away December 11, 2015 in Nocona. She was born Lyndall Lou Gallion to Ronald and Marian Lyndall (Lankford) Gallion in Tulsa, OK. Lindy was a very active volunteer and member in the community. She helped start the Nocona Public Library, the Carpenter Shop senior citizen's center, and Keep Nocona Beautiful. She was active in Epsilon Sigma Alpha and the Eastern Star, and she retired after two terms as Montague County Tax Assessor/ Collector. Lindy was also Nocona citizen of the year not once but twice. Lindy married Joe Berry Ritchie and had two children, Randy and Larry. Lindy was preceded in death by her husband Joe Berry. She is survived by her sons, Randy and wife Mary Ritchie of Nocona, and Larry Ritchie, also of Nocona, and her sister Roni Agress of Redding Connecticut. Lindy was a very active and well known member of the community of Nocona and of Montague County, and she will be deeply missed. Lindy's family is under the care of Scott-Morris Funeral Home, but no memorial service is planned at this time. Memorials may be made in her name to Solaris Hospice.
